Dr. Yunus made Chancellor of Malaysian Varsity

UNB, Dhaka :
Nobel Laureate Professor Muhammad Yunus, also founder of Grameen Bank, has been appointed as the Inaugural Chancellor of Albukhary International University (AIU) in Malaysia, reports Strait Times.
Yunus, who is also the Chancellor of Glasgow Caledonian University, UK and the Chairman of Yunus Centre , has been appointed based on his contributions, knowledge, expertise and experience in developing the world-recognised Social Business agenda through various forms of awards he received.
“His appointment as Chancellor of AIU is in line with the Philosophy, Vision and Mission of the establishment of AIU to develop graduates or future leaders who are adaptable, balanced, well-rounded individuals, willing and able to serve humanity, acting as change agents in respective communities through Social Business agenda,” said Vice Chancellor and President of Albukhary International University, Prof. Datuk Dr. Abd. Aziz Tajuddin, in a statement.
“The application of social business values, especially the Seven Principles of Social Business introduced by Professor Muhammad Yunus is implemented through the curriculum, academic, non-academic and research activities that would add value to students who are expected to be successful Social Entrepreneurs upon graduation,” said Prof. Datuk Dr. Abd. Aziz Tajuddin.
